Advanced Tactics

Apart from the fundamental strategies, advanced tactics can set you apart from other players. Mastering these can significantly impact your performance and overall enjoyment of the game.

Strategic Positioning

Understanding the map and positioning yourself wisely can often be the difference between victory and defeat. Here are some tips:

  • High Ground Advantage: Always seek higher ground when available. It offers better visibility and can provide cover against attacks.
  • Flanking: Approach your enemies from unexpected angles. This can catch them off guard and give you the upper hand in combat.
  • Utilize Cover: Always be aware of your surroundings and use natural cover to shield yourself from enemy fire.

Resource Management

In many games, managing your resources effectively is crucial. This applies to health, ammunition, or in-game currency. Here are some guidelines:

  • Conserve Resources: Use your supplies wisely; don”t waste ammo or health packs unless absolutely necessary.
  • Upgrade Smartly: Prioritize upgrades that will have the most significant impact on your gameplay.
  • Know When to Retreat: Sometimes, the best strategy is to retreat and regroup rather than fight to the last resource.

Game Theory: Strategic Thinking in Gaming

Understanding game theory can provide players with a deeper insight into strategic decision-making. This branch of mathematics analyzes situations where players make decisions that are interdependent, impacting the outcomes for all involved. Here”s how it applies to gaming:

Strategic Interactions

In many games, your choices affect not just your outcome but also that of your opponents. Recognizing this interdependence can help you:

  • Anticipate Moves: Predict opponents’ actions based on their previous behavior and your understanding of their playstyle.
  • Bluffing and Deception: Use tactics to mislead opponents, such as feigning weakness to draw them into traps.
  • Negotiation Skills: In multiplayer games, forming alliances can be beneficial; knowing when to cooperate and when to betray is crucial.

Identifying Dominant Strategies

A dominant strategy is one that performs better for a player, regardless of what opponents do. Here”s how to identify and utilize them:

  • Assess Payoffs: Evaluate the outcomes of different strategies to identify which consistently yields the best results.
  • Adapt to Changes: Be flexible and ready to shift your strategy based on the evolving dynamics of the game.
  • Learn from Experience: Reflect on past games to identify which strategies have proven successful in various scenarios.
